The import volume of artificial corundum to Germany is anticipated to grow from 156.94 million kilograms in 2024 to 163.69 million kilograms by 2028. This continuous upward trend reflects a steady year-on-year growth, estimated to average a compounded annual growth rate (CAGR) over the five years from 2024 to 2028, indicative of a stable and gradually increasing demand. In 2023, the actual import volume provided a baseline for the forecasted increment, with specific annual growth rates continuously underlining positive momentum in import activities.
Future trends to watch for include the impact of technological advancements on production efficiency, potential changes in global demand for artificial corundum across various industries, and any regulatory adjustments regarding import-export policies within the European Union that could influence market dynamics.
